So I just started taking birth control [Ortho Tri-Cyclen] and I was just curious how long it takes to start working. I just had sex for the first time but we used a condom as well because i knew that the birth control wasnt going to work just yet. Ive heard that it only takes a week..some say two weeks. I just wanted to know because even though youre supossed to use a condom in addition to the pill I just want to be sure im okay if some how the condoms arent reliable.

by QuestionableMotive, Jul 21, 2007 12:00AM
Most methods of birth control work within 1 - 3 weeks but to be positive you should wait a full cycle (one month).
